
How to Propagate Indian rose chestnut?
(Mesua ferrea)
Indian rose chestnut, also known as Ceylon ironwood
Indian rose chestnut can be effectively propagated through the method of cuttings. To enhance rooting success, utilize semi-hardwood cuttings taken from healthy parent plants. These cuttings should ideally be treated with a rooting hormone to promote the development of roots. Plant these cuttings in a well-draining, sterile potting mix to prevent diseases and ensure good moisture retention without waterlogging. Regular monitoring for moisture levels and root development is crucial for optimal growth.
